NuHealth Employee Recognized By US Coast Guard

Ronald Tomo, NuHealth's chief information officer, was honored for his support of the Coast Guard in the wake of Hurricane Sandy.

Ronald Tomo, the chief finical officer of NuHealth was recently recognized by the US Coast Guard for his contributions and support of the Coast Guard's Communication Area Master Station Atlantic (CAMSLANT) in the wake of Hurricane Sandy.

Tomo was was presented with a certificate by Capt. Frank E. Pedras, Jr., commanding officer of CAMSLANT, which provides technical communications assistance and training to other Coast Guard units.

“Congratulations! Through your dedicated and unselfish efforts you ensured that vital calling and distress communications were available by providing the critical monitoring of high frequency distress channels, Pedras told Tomo.  "Your efforts ensured CAMSLANT was able to live up to its motto of 'No Call Unanswered.'”

NUHealth is a public benefit corporation that manages the operations of Nassau University Medical Center in East Meadow.
